Groenheid
Groenheid is a Dutch noun that denotes the quality or state of being green, or the color green itself. The term is used for both the literal color of objects and for the presence of green vegetation. It is formed from groen and the abstract-noun suffix -heid, which marks a state, quality, or condition.
